采动影响下矿井突水水源Fisher判别与地下水补给关系反演  被引量:13

Fisher discriminant analysis for coal mining inrush water source under mining-induced disturbance and inversion of groundwater recharge relation

摘  要:为了揭示采动影响下矿井突水水源误判原因,进而推测地下水补给关系,收集了朱仙庄煤矿历年水化学资料,建立了突水水源的Fisher判别模型,并根据水样误判结果以及矿井地质与水文地质条件,反演分析了地下水补给关系。研究结果表明朱仙庄煤矿煤系砂岩裂隙含水层全部水样回判正确,含水层较为封闭,与其他含水层无水力联系;新生界第四含水层、侏罗系砾岩含水层与石炭系或奥陶系灰岩含水层部分水样误判,矿井采动影响下不同时期含水层间的地下水存在不同程度的水力联系,矿井新生界第四含水层水源对侏罗系砾岩含水层存在补给,石炭系或奥陶系灰岩水则通过矿井南部露水补给新生界第四含水层。地下水动力条件的变化验证了地下水补给关系。建立突水水源判别模型,分析回代误判原因,反演地下水补给关系,为正确认识矿井采动影响下地下水循环条件提出了新的研究手段。To reveal the cause of inaccurate discrimination of inrush water samples under mining-induced disturbance,and to speculate on the groundwater recharge relation,a Fisher discriminant model of inrush water source was established based on the past hydrochemical data from the Zhuxianzhuang coal mine.According to the results of inaccurate discrimination and its geological and hydrogeological conditions,the groundwater recharge relation was inversed.All water samples from the coal-bearing formation aquifer were correctly discriminated.It is concluded that the aquifer is relatively sealed and has little hydraulic connection with other aquifers.However,some water samples from the fourth aquifer of the Quaternary,the Jurassic conglomerate aquifer and the Carboniferous or Ordovician limestone aquifers were incorrectly discriminated,indicating that the aquifers have hydraulic connection to different degree in the process of coal mining.The inaccurate discrimination includes the recharge of the fourth aquifer of the Quaternary to the Jurassic conglomerate aquifer,and the recharge of the limestone aquifer to the fourth aquifer of the Quaternary through the south outcrop of the coal mine,which is validated by the dynamic condition of groundwater.A new research means is put forward by establishing discrimination model of inrush water source,analyzing the cause of inaccurate discrimination and inversing the groundwater recharge relation in order to understand exactly the cycle of groundwater under mining-induced disturbance in a coal mine.
